Hearts of Oak defender Samuel Inkoom has apologised to the club for missing a penalty in their FA Cup clash against Dreams FC on Sunday.
The Phobians failed to defend the title after losing 1-0 to the Dawu-based side which eventually ousted them from the competition.
The experienced right-back stepped up to take the spot kick after the defending champions were given a penalty in the 97th minute.
Inkoom, however, failed to beat goalkeeper Augustine Koomson and it proved costly as the defender struck wide with his effort.
